How to edit a file with Neovim+iTerm2 on MacOS

Finder → iTerm2 + Neovim handler

Double-clicking a source or config file in Finder opens it in Neovim inside a new iTerm2 window. Selecting multiple files opens them as tabs in a single window (nvim -p).

Requirements

  • iTerm2
  • Neovim (nvim on $PATH)
  • duti: brew install duti

Customize Firefox Toolbar Layout with userChrome.css
@namespace url("http://www.mozilla.org/keymaster/gatekeeper/there.is.only.xul"); /* only needed once */
/* Placing the config file */
/* Go to about:support address, find Profile folder, open it */
/* Create an empty directory named `chrome` in that */
/* Add this file in that directory with name userChrome.css */
/* Activating the configuration */
/* Go to address about:config, then set => toolkit.legacyUserProfileCustomizations.stylesheets: true */
